A Self Directed Support Academy is to be established
With the 'personalisation' agenda now becoming a major priority, the big
challenge for services and for the people they support is how to make self
directed support work in ways that gives people real control over their
lives. To help with this challenge, CSIP have established a self directed
support (SDS) support plan.
Amanda Reynolds, Social Care Change Agent, CSIP Eastern would like to set
up an SDS 'academy', which would be made up of individuals who have
managed their own support using individual budgets, direct payments or any
other way, and who would themselves be interested in helping both other
people and services understand the benefits, and the best ways to develop
the opportunities in person centred ways. These academy members would be
involved in assisting CSIP with its SDS support plan by giving
presentations, helping with training, and advising those responsible for
implementing policy.
CSIP Eastern knows that one of the most powerful ways to increase learning
is to use the direct experiences of people involved in something to inform
